Transparent Pricing
Simcoe County additions range $50K–$500K+, averaging $300–$550/sq ft (2026 GTA rates). We provide fixed quotes post-site visit that cover everything — no surprises.
| Addition Type | Sq Ft Range | Cost / Sq Ft | Total Estimate | Key Factors |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Bump-Out / Extension | 50 – 150 sq ft | $350 – $600 | $20K – $90K | Framing & finishes |
| Rear Kitchen Extension | 150 – 600 sq ft | $300 – $500 | $45K – $300K | Foundation & HVAC |
| Sunroom / Garage | 200 – 400 sq ft | $250 – $450 | $50K – $180K | Insulation & windows |
| Second-Storey Addition | 400 – 1,200 sq ft | $350 – $550 | $140K – $660K | Roof & engineering |
| Custom High-End | 800+ sq ft | $500 – $800+ | $400K – $1M+ | Luxury materials |
Cost Drivers to Know: Structural work adds $50–$100/sq ft; permits typically represent 5–10% of the budget; site conditions vary; finishes account for 20–40% variance. Highest-ROI picks: second-storey additions and kitchen expansions consistently deliver the best return.

We Handle It All
The Township of King requires permits for code, zoning, and safety compliance. We manage the full process so you avoid fines, delays, or stop-work orders.
Initial application review completed within 5 business days.
Approvals from zoning and conservation authority — typically 2 weeks to 3 months.
All permit fees and deposits per township by-law — included in your fixed quote.
Digital permit issued via CityView — construction-ready clearance confirmed.
Foundation, framing, and final inspections scheduled and coordinated on your behalf.
Skipping or mismanaging permits risks stop-work orders, insurance voids, resale complications, and safety liability. Simple additions are typically approved in 2–3 months — we start the clock on day one.

For smaller additions (bump-outs, sunrooms, garage conversions), most homeowners can remain in their home throughout. For larger second-storey projects or major structural work, temporary relocation may be necessary — we advise you upfront during planning.
An "addition" typically refers to going up (second-storey), while an "extension" refers to going out (rear or side extensions that expand the footprint). We handle both, and both require permits and structural engineering.
